Page 1347
9861. WILLIAM 9, son of James 8 (3992), b. in East Amherst, Mass., 28 May, 1820; m. 23 Oct., 1873, Harriet Strickland Fitch, b. 4 Nov., 1843, dau. of Francis William Fitch, of New London, b. in Chesterfield, Conn., 14 Oct, 1811, son of William Fitch, and Elizabeth Tinker Cook, b..24 Feb., 1819. He d. 17 Mar., 1897; after his death she res. in.Amherst. He was a merchant and manufacturer ; res, in Amherst; succeeded his father in the business of making carpenter's and moulder's planes; in 1886 the business was discontinued. Kellogg's block on Phoenix Bow, Amherst, was built by him in 1860.
Children:
16209 James William 10, b. 6. Sept., 1878; res., unm., in Amherst.
16210 Francis Whittlesey 10, b.,1 May, 1881; is unm.
16211 Edward Latimer 10 b. 27 June, 1882; is unm.
